South’s theater department has received nominations for its productions throughout the 2022-23 school year. The cast and crew of ‘Mamma Mia!’ earned seven Blue Star Award nominations. Blue Star is hosted by Starlight Theatre. Fifty-four area high schools compete in various categories. Here are the nominees:

The theater department also received nominations for ‘Mamma Mia!’ and ‘Clue: On Stage’ from Cappies KC. The organization has over 20 participating schools in the area. Here are the nominees:
